The Current State of Gambling Regulations
The legal landscape of gambling has undergone significant transformations in recent years, influenced by technological advancements and changing public perceptions. As various jurisdictions revisit their gambling laws, it has become essential for stakeholders to stay informed about the current regulations governing both land-based and online gaming. Each state or country can have its unique stance on gambling, resulting in a patchwork of rules that can often be complex to navigate.
For example, while some regions have embraced online gambling, allowing sites to flourish with minimal restrictions, others maintain strict prohibitions. This disparity not only impacts gambling operators but also consumers who may find themselves at risk when participating in unregulated environments. A clear understanding of these regulations is crucial for both players and operators to ensure compliance and protect their interests.
Moreover, the rise of cryptocurrencies and blockchain technology is adding another layer of complexity to the gambling regulatory framework. As digital currencies gain traction, regulators are challenged to adapt existing laws or create new ones to encompass these innovations. This dynamic environment necessitates ongoing education and adaptation for everyone involved in the gambling ecosystem.
The Role of Technology in Shaping Regulations
Technology has revolutionized how gambling is conducted, from online casinos to mobile betting apps, necessitating updates to existing laws. As operators leverage advanced technology to enhance user experiences, regulators are tasked with ensuring that these innovations are safe and fair. This often involves the implementation of rigorous licensing processes and compliance checks to protect consumers from fraud and exploitation.
For example, many jurisdictions now require operators to adopt Random Number Generators (RNGs) to ensure fair play in online games. These technological measures are essential in maintaining transparency and trust within the gambling community. However, the speed of technological advancement can often outpace regulatory measures, leading to potential gaps in consumer protection.
Additionally, the integration of artificial intelligence and big data in gambling operations raises significant questions about privacy and data security. Regulators must establish guidelines that protect consumer data while allowing companies to utilize these technologies for enhanced operational efficiency. Striking this balance will be crucial as the industry continues to evolve and attract a broader audience.
The Importance of Responsible Gambling Initiatives
As gambling becomes more accessible, the need for responsible gambling initiatives has never been more pressing. Regulatory bodies are increasingly focusing on measures that protect vulnerable populations, including self-exclusion programs and mandatory risk awareness campaigns. These initiatives aim to educate gamblers about the risks associated with gambling while providing resources for those who may be developing problematic habits.
For instance, several jurisdictions now require operators to display information about responsible gambling prominently on their websites and platforms. This initiative helps foster a culture of responsibility and encourages gamblers to engage in self-reflection regarding their gaming habits. Operators that prioritize responsible gambling practices often see enhanced customer loyalty and improved brand reputation.
Moreover, collaboration between regulators, operators, and advocacy groups is vital in creating a comprehensive framework for responsible gambling. By working together, these stakeholders can develop innovative solutions and resources that address the specific needs of various communities, ensuring that the gambling landscape remains safe and enjoyable for all participants.
Future Trends in Gambling Legislation
The future of gambling regulations is poised to be shaped by several emerging trends, reflecting broader societal changes and technological advancements. One notable trend is the increasing acceptance and legalization of sports betting, which has gained momentum following landmark court rulings in various countries. As more jurisdictions permit sports wagering, the regulatory landscape will need to adapt, ensuring fair play and consumer protection in this rapidly growing sector.
In addition to sports betting, the integration of virtual reality and augmented reality in gambling is anticipated to change the way consumers experience gaming. This evolution may prompt regulators to consider new frameworks that address the unique challenges associated with these technologies, including issues of addiction and immersive gaming experiences. These developments will likely require ongoing dialogue between stakeholders to ensure that regulations keep pace with technological innovations.
Finally, as global gambling markets become increasingly interconnected, there may be a shift towards harmonizing regulations across borders. Such standardization could simplify compliance for operators while enhancing consumer protection. However, achieving consensus among various jurisdictions poses its own challenges, necessitating collaborative efforts and dialogue to craft effective and inclusive regulations.
